How much does a Salesforce implementation cost?

Most Salesforce implementations run $50,000 to $500,000 depending on clouds, customization, data migration, and integrations; enterprise multi-cloud programs run into seven figures.

How long does a Salesforce implementation take?

A focused single-cloud implementation typically takes 8 to 16 weeks; multi-cloud or heavily customized enterprise rollouts run six months or more.

What should I check before hiring a Salesforce implementation company?

Verify four things: the actual delivery team (not just the sales bench), two or three references from comparable projects, audited security and quality credentials such as ISO 27001 or SOC 2 Type II, and a written discovery output - architecture, data-migration plan, and integration map - before you sign a full build contract.

Should we implement Salesforce in-house or hire an implementation company?

Hire a partner for the initial build if your team has not shipped a comparable Salesforce program before; first-time in-house implementations commonly overrun on data migration and integrations. A good middle path is partner-led delivery with your admins embedded, full code and documentation handover, then internalizing operations once the platform is stable.

Can a partner rescue a failed or stalled Salesforce implementation?

Yes. Rescue and technical-debt remediation is a distinct discipline, weighted at 12 of 100 points in our methodology. Expect a paid audit first: a credible partner will diagnose the org, quantify the technical debt, and give you a written stabilization plan before proposing a rebuild.
